Outgoing UN Envoy Susan Namondo Commends Uganda’s Role as Anchor of Regional Peace and Stability

Susan Ngongi Namondo, the outgoing United Nations Resident Coordinator in Uganda, this afternoon paid a courtesy visit to the Chief of Defence Forces and Senior Presidential Adviser for Special Operations, Gen Muhoozi Kainerugaba.

During the visit to the SFC Headquarters in Entebbe, Her Excellency Namondo expressed her appreciation for the working relationship between Uganda and the United Nations, thanking the CDF for his role in strengthening these relations.

Namondo, who has been in Uganda since 2021, will now be going to Tanzania in the same role after concluding her duties in Uganda.

Gen Kainerugaba thanked her for her service and efforts to strengthen relations with the UN body through policies that align with national interests.

The General also congratulated her, noting that during Her Excellency’s tenure, Uganda’s UN team had exceeded global standards on the Gender Equality Scorecard.

Meanwhile, Her Excellency expressed her appreciation to the Chief of Defence Forces for his unwavering support to her and the broader UN family during her tenure.

She highlighted Uganda’s commendable role as an anchor of peace within the region and its consistent efforts in promoting regional stability.

She further emphasized the critical importance of close coordination between the Government of Uganda and development partners, noting that this alignment is essential for achieving cohesive and impactful development outcomes.
